Output 8f334f6abd3af708a00859658bce6a92efd1e7e200aff696b45f5fcbce323a52:1

value
23867435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b940f868eadd6a8facfbdf92e0a0862d7dd6fb3 OP_EQUAL
address
MDLBUBXT9fdMQhpx6K66n35LKNenVDdcAE
transaction
8f334f6abd3af708a00859658bce6a92efd1e7e200aff696b45f5fcbce323a52
spent
true